Lack of Experience and Practice

One of the primary reasons why your boyfriend may struggle with skateboarding is simply due to a lack of experience and practice. Skateboarding is not an innate skill that everyone possesses naturally; it requires consistent effort and practice to master. If your boyfriend has never skateboarded before or has only recently started, it is understandable that he may face difficulties in maintaining balance, executing tricks, and riding smoothly.

Physical Limitations

Skateboarding demands a certain level of physical fitness and coordination. It requires balance, strength, flexibility, and agility. If your boyfriend lacks in any of these areas, he may find it challenging to skate proficiently. For example, if he struggles with balance or has limited upper body strength, it can affect his ability to perform tricks and maintain control over the board.

Mental and Psychological Factors

Skateboarding is not only physically demanding but also mentally challenging. Fear and anxiety can hinder one's progress in learning new tricks or attempting more advanced moves. If your boyfriend experiences fear of falling or getting injured, it can significantly impede his progress in learning to skate. Building confidence, overcoming fears, and developing mental resilience are essential components of becoming a proficient skateboarder.

Lack of Proper Equipment

Skateboarding requires appropriate gear and equipment to ensure safety and optimal performance. If your boyfriend is using an old or poorly maintained skateboard, it can affect his ability to skate comfortably and safely. A skateboard with worn-out wheels, loose trucks, or a warped deck can make it significantly harder to maintain balance and execute tricks effectively. Encourage your boyfriend to invest in good quality equipment that suits his skill level and riding style.
